How Our Carpet Water Damage Restoration Process Works
When you call us for carpet water damage restoration, you can expect a thorough process that gets your carpets dry and looking like new. We’ll start by ass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to address it. Our team will then use specialized equipment to extract the water, dry your carpets, and prevent mold growth. We’ll work efficiently to get the job done within 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and create a customized plan to restore your carpets. We’ll identify the source of the water and take steps to pr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ade equipment to extract the water from your carpets, including wet/dry vacuums and extractors.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ry your carpets and dehumidify the air, ensuring your property is safe and dry.
Step 4: Mold Prevention and Removal
We’ll use ant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old growth and remove any existing mold from your carpets.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your carpets are dry, clean, and free of damage. We’ll also provide recommendations for future maintenance to prevent water damage.

Carpet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ill, quickly cleaned up |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small spills, but be sure to dry the area quickly to prevent damage. |
| Large water spill, multiple rooms affected | No | Yes | For large water spills, it’s best to call a professional to ensure thorough drying and prevention of mold growth. |
| Water damage caused by a burst pipe | No | Yes | Water damage caused by a burst pipe needs immediate attention from a professional to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Carpet water damage in a high-traffic area | No | Yes | Carpet water damage in high-traffic areas need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safe walking surfaces. |
| Water damage caused by a storm or flood | No | Yes | Water damage caused by a storm or flood needs professional attention to ensure thorough drying, mold prevention, and safe living conditions. |

Carpet Water Damage Restoration Cost In Morris, OK
The cost of carpet water damage restoration var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Morris, OK.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. Here are some typical price ranges for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the damage and size of the affected area |
| Mold Prevention and Removal |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of mold growth and affected area |
| Carpet Replacement (if necessary) |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size and type of carpet, as well as the extent of damage |
| More Services (e.g., drywall repair, painting) | $500 – $2,000 | The extent and complexity of the more work |

Common Questions About Carpet Water Damage Restoration
Q: Is water damage covered by my homeowners insurance?
A: Yes, water damage is typically covered by homeowners insurance. But, the specifics of your policy will find out what’s covered and what’s not. Our team can help you navigate the process and ensure you get the coverage you deserve.
Q: How long does the restoration process take?
A: The restoration process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to get the job done as quickly as possible.
Q: Is mold growth a serious health risk?
A: Yes, mold growth can be a serious health risk, especially for people with allergies or respiratory issues. Our team uses ant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old growth and ensure your property is safe.
Q: Can I prevent water damage by fixing leaks quickly?
A: Yes, fixing leaks quickly is one of the best ways to prevent water damage. Regular maintenance and inspections can also help identify potential issues before they become major problems.
